Subject: EXIF scrub cut-over — done!

Hi support folks,

Quick recap: we finished moving photo uploads to the new Scrubline pipeline last night. All images are now stripped of EXIF metadata (location, device info, the works) before hitting storage. Old uploads are being backfilled over the next week, so expect a few "why does my old photo still show GPS" tickets until then. If customers ask what the service enforces, these are the active settings.

deployment values, kajep-kageg:
[praix]
host = praix.paliqcorp.corp
user = praix_svc
database = praix_prod

## Runbook: Pagination in the Skylark Public API

All list endpoints use cursor-based pagination. Responses include a next_cursor field; pass it back as the cursor query parameter to fetch the following page. Page size defaults to 50, maximum 200. Cursors expire after 15 minutes, so long-running exports should checkpoint regularly.

When debugging pagination issues, compare public responses against the internal index service, which exposes raw offsets. That service requires separate key authentication. The key for the internal index service is:

gateway credential: kto23_LX9A4ys6i4nzHtpOLNLodKK

Ticket: resizefox CLI mishandles batch jobs containing zero-byte images — the worker pool stalls instead of skipping the file. Fix: validate inputs before enqueueing and emit a per-file warning in the summary report. Future maintainers should note the pool intentionally has no timeout; adding one would break long-running TIFF conversions. Regression test added under the batch suite. Fixed and verified in the build referenced below.

trace token, fafog-kageg: htk4_98e6